Doctors Are Using AI Far More Often, but Mostly for Documentation and Knowledge Summaries
New AMA survey results reported by Fierce Healthcare show physician use of AI has more than doubled since 2023, reaching 81% in a professional context by 2026. The growth is being driven less by autonomous diagnosis than by documentation and research summarization, revealing where AI is actually gaining traction in care settings.
UCLA Study Finds AI Ambient Scribes Reduce Documentation Time and Improve Physician Well-Being
A randomized clinical trial at UCLA compared two ambient AI scribe systems and found meaningful reductions in documentation time per note and improvements in physician burnout measures, though AI-generated notes occasionally contained clinically significant inaccuracies.
